Supersized personal video player

8-inch portable video player

We're not even sure we feel comfortable tossing this one in the "Portable Video" category, but DAPreview spotted this massively personal video player with a massive 8-inch screen that's even bigger than the 6.5-inch screen found on the DVX-POD 7010 (and that bad boy is already as big as we like these babies to get). No word on what kind of battery life this thing gets, but we do know that it'll come with up to an 80GB hard drive, a CompactFlash memory card reader, built-in stereo speakers, and support for playback of MPEG-1, MPEG-2 (including VOB), MPEG-4, DivX, and AVI video files, as well as WMA, WAV, and MP3 audio files. Hard to imagine anyone casually lugging this around, at least not when you could carry something a little more useful around like a laptop or a small tablet PC instead, but if the battery life is good enough we could actually see families tossing these in the backseat during roadtrips.
